The Megaplier was made available to all Mega Millions jurisdictions in January 2011 it began as an option available only in Texas. Of the 47 Mega Millions jurisdictions, all but California offer an option, called Megaplier (plays with the Megaplier are $3 each) where non-jackpot prizes are multiplied by 2, 3, 4, or 5. The current version of Mega Millions requires players to match 5 of 70 white balls, and the gold-colored "MegaBall" from a second field, of 25 numbers ( 5/70 / 1/25).Įach game costs $2. Mega Millions' previous format began on Octoits first drawing was three days later. A cash value option (the usual choice), when chosen by a jackpot winner, pays the approximate present value of the installments. Reflecting common practice among American lotteries, the jackpot is advertised as a nominal value of annual installments. Under the current version's regulations (which began Octowith the first drawing October 31) for Mega Millions, the minimum Mega Millions advertised jackpot is $40 million, paid in 30 graduated yearly installments, increasing 5% each year (unless the cash option is chosen see below for differences by lotteries on cash/annuity choice regulations.)
